Cody Dearing had a goal and an assist as the Great Falls Americans defeated the Bozeman Icedogs 5-2 Saturday night in a season opening NA3HL hockey game at the Great Falls IcePlex.

The Americans of coach Jeff Heimel also got goals from Garrett Peters, Matt Janke, Luke Richesin and Nate Simpson. Payton McSharry, Tanner Rath, Braxton Lorenz,  and Adam Vandebos notched assists for Great Falls.

Mack Willey was the victorious goaltender stopping 14 of 16 shots.

The Americans who outshot the Icedogs 59-16, broke away from a 2-2 tie by scoring three unanswered goals in the second period.
